Avoiding The High Price Of Custom Vanities, But Getting The Same Look    By: Jason Delmar
A custom bathroom vanity may sound like a great idea when you are remodeling your bathroom (who doesn't want their bathroom to be truly unique). People usually change their minds right at the point when they find out how much a custom vanity will cost. To find a true craftsman that will hand-make a custom vanity for you, can easily end up costing you thousands. Not to mention the fact, that it could take months for it to be built. If you have plenty of time, and a lot of disposable income, then a custom vanity may still be an option for you (for most homeowners, it is simply out of the question).(read entire article)(posted on: 2009-01-20)

Facts About Stock Kitchen Cabinets    By: Jason Delmar
Let's face it, over the years stock cabinets have developed a reputation of being contractor grade or a cheaper version of custom cabinets. The image that comes to mind for me would have to be oak cabinets with particle board sides. Over the 10 years, manufacturers have really made some significant improvements in the quality of stock cabinets. In fact, some of the stock cabinets and even RTA cabinets that are on the market now are indistinguishable from semi-custom cabinets (without the high price tag).(read entire article)(posted on: 2009-01-19)

Differentiating Between Kitchen Cabinet Box Styles    By: Jason Delmar
At first glance, kitchen cabinets may all seem the same. People rarely stop to think about what else cabinets consist of, when in fact the most important part of the cabinet itself is behind the facade. The structure to which the doors are attached is the main component of kitchen cabinets. Without a strong support structure, cabinets would be nothing more than decoration. There are two primary structures for cabinets, framed and frameless construction. Each style creates a unique appearance for the cabinets and requires very different methods of fastening the structure of the cabinet.(read entire article)(posted on: 2009-01-18)
